Biography

Antonino Castro is born and baptized 21 December 1827 in Corleone. He is the first born child of Maestro Carmelo Castro and Pietra Bordonaro, named after his paternal grandfather, as is traditional. His godparents are Ignazio Cusimano and Biagia Bordonaro, who are not married.

There is a duplicate baptismal record for Antonino on 20 January 1828.

His father, Carmelo, becomes a maestro by 1834. Two of Antonino's paternal uncles are also master carpenters, making it likely also Carmelo's profession.

In 1834, Antonio, 6 (b. 1827), lives on the strada Grande with his parents, Maestro Carmelo, 32 (b. 1799, he is 35), and Pietra, 29 (b. 1805), and his sisters Maria Antonia, 8 (b. 1826), and Bernarda, 4 (b. 1840). Another name, Filippo, is written, then crossed out and a cross written next to his name, suggesting he has died. There is no known son of this family named Filippo.

Two houses to the west on the strada di Favaloro (which is now called via Ostieri to the west of via Candelora, and via Mancaluso to the east), there is the family of Antonio Oliveri.

Antonino's father dies at age 50 (b. 1797) on 11 July 1847. The same year, his youngest brother, Gaetano, is born in January and dies in November.

Maestro Antonino has become a master carpenter (falegname) by the time he marries for the first time, in 1854.

Marriage to Francesca Paola de Luca

Maestro Antonino marries Francesca Paola de Luca (of unknown relation to the midwife of the same name, who is a generation older) on 24 July 1854.[1]

During the 1850s, Antonino lives with his wife Francesca Paola de Luca on via San Pietro in Corleone. They have at least four children: Carmela (1855), Carmelo (1856), Pietra (1857), and Maria Carmela (1859).

Carmela is born and baptized Carmelam on 6 May 1855. Her godparents are Leoluca Cascio and Maria Antonia, his unmarried sister.

She dies at eight days of age.

Carmelo is born and baptized Carmelum on 27 March 1856. His godparents are Ignazio and Stefana Milone, brother and sister.

Carmelo dies on 1 December 1856 at eight months of age.

Pietra is born and baptized Petram on 5 September 1857, named after her paternal grandmother. Her godparents are Matteo Salemi and paternal aunt Bernarda lo Cascio, a married couple.
Maria Carmela is born 28 September 1859 and baptized the following day. Her godfather is Biagio Bucchieri, who is unmarried.

Carmelo's mother, Pietra, dies at age 84 (b. 1795) on 29 April 1879.

His daughter, Pietra, marries Antonino Pulizzi on 26 April 1880.

Marriage to Arcangela Migliaccio

It is unknown when his wife passes away, but on 5 December 1882, we find Antonino lo Cascio, widower of Francesca Paola Lo Luca, marrying another widow, a washer woman from Prizzi named Arcangela Migliaccio.

Pietra and Carmelo, Antonino's children from his first marriage, stand as godparents to Biagia Mancuso on 13 November 1893.
